الوصف: A female patient in middle childhood was diagnosed with coarctation of the aorta at one month of age and underwent a successful cortectomy. At 11 years old, she developed re-coarctation, which was managed through interventional cardiology. Shortly after the procedure, she experienced a sudden and severe clinical decline, presenting with hypoperfusion of the lower extremities, gastrointestinal bleeding, acute kidney injury, and pancreatitis. Multiple thrombotic events were identified, prompting an extensive evaluation for thrombophilia . The patient tested positive for antiphospholipid antibodies and was diagnosed with catastrophic antiphospholipid antibody syndrome (CAPS). An aggressive treatment was initiated, yielding a favorable response following discharge; she made a full recovery and continues to be monitored regularly in cardiology and rheumatology clinics.
